For those who don't know, stock eliminator allows no cylinder head porting (Even on E7s), no intake porting and you have to stay 302 cubic inches with a stock lift cam.
Now I wasn't thinking of doing his exactly...You cant exactly daily drive a 25x/26x @.050 cam...Especially with ridiculous gears and lots of compression.
I'm thinking about doing something similar...Stock heads/intake but ported...Solid roller cam with good valvetrain and eagle rods/CP pistons with about 11.0:1 and 4.30 gears. The reason being, because its cool and its within my budget/timeframe. I can finish it by the end of the year and ill be going faster than my current combo.
My co-worker built a 92 hatch with a stock crank, eagle rods, 13:1 compression, stock unported heads (had a little bowl work done), stock unported intake, stock lift cam, 24 pound injectors and a tuneable computer. It weighed 3200 with him in it and the best it went was an 11.90 @ 110mph with a 1.53 sixty foot. It also had 5.13 gears and a 5500 stall.
